
When it comes to charging your new electric vehicle in Stephenville, you have several options, each with different plugs and ports. However, with available charging adapters, you’re not limited to a single method. The question, “how long does it take to charge an electric car?” depends on which option you choose. Additionally, charging time varies based on the type, make, and model of your EV.
Different EVs come with various battery packs that have distinct charging times. Therefore, it’s challenging to provide a definitive answer that applies to all vehicles. Nevertheless, we can guide you through the three main types of EV charging — domestic charging, rapid domestic charging, and public charging — and explain how your choice will impact your charging time. Your new EV will come with a Level 1 charger. Most drivers keep this in the vehicle as a backup, rather than using it as a sole charging method. Level 1 chargers provide an estimated four miles of range per charging hour.
Level 2 (240V+) chargers must be professionally installed and can charge your EV much faster than level 1 chargers. Level 2 chargers provide an estimated 24 miles of range per charging hour.
Level 2 public charging stations are more and more common around Brownwood and Abilene, and they provide similar charging speeds to level 2 home chargers. You can often find them at major retailers like Walgreens, Kohl’s, and Whole Foods, as well as at universities, hotels, and parking garages.
Some public chargers offer 150 kW rapid charging, and these can power up your EV faster than any other charging method. However, they’re usually only available along major highways and freeways and cannot be installed at home. Level 3 chargers provide up to 60 to 100 miles of range per twenty minutes of charging.
Do you drive a plug-in hybrid? If so, your charging times could be significantly shorter. Typically, these vehicles take between 1 to 4 hours to fully charge. Why is this? Plug-in hybrid vehicles don’t rely solely on electricity; they use a combination of electric power and gasoline. Often, they operate on electric power for short distances or at lower speeds before switching to gasoline.
So, how long is a fully electric car charging time? Most home chargers provide 3.7 kW or 7 kW charging. In contrast, public stations offer more powerful options: 22 kW charging, 43-50 kW rapid charging, and 150 kW rapid charging. Depending on your vehicle, this means you could achieve a full charge (0-100%) in about an hour with rapid charging. Alternatively, it might take 4, 6, or even 11 hours to fully charge your vehicle, depending on the charging method and your car’s battery capacity.
